GLmark2
This is a test of Linaro's glmark2 port, currently using the X11 OpenGL 2.0 target. GLmark2 is a basic OpenGL benchmark. Learn more via the OpenBenchmarking.org test page.
GpuTest
GpuTest is a cross-platform OpenGL benchmark developed at Geeks3D.com that offers tech demos such as FurMark, TessMark, and other workloads to stress various areas of GPUs and drivers. Learn more via the OpenBenchmarking.org test page.
OpenArena
This is a test of OpenArena, a popular open-source first-person shooter. This game is based upon ioquake3, which in turn uses the GPL version of id Software's Quake 3 engine. Learn more via the OpenBenchmarking.org test page.
Unigine Heaven
This test calculates the average frame-rate within the Heaven demo for the Unigine engine. This engine is extremely demanding on the system's graphics card. Learn more via the OpenBenchmarking.org test page.
Unigine Sanctuary
This test calculates the average frame-rate within the Sanctuary demo for the Unigine engine. This engine is very demanding on the system's graphics card. Learn more via the OpenBenchmarking.org test page.
Unigine Tropics
This test calculates the average frame-rate within the Tropics / Islands demo for the Unigine engine. This engine is very demanding on the system's graphics card. Learn more via the OpenBenchmarking.org test page.
Unigine Valley
This test calculates the average frame-rate within the Valley demo for the Unigine engine, released in February 2013. This engine is extremely demanding on the system's graphics card. Unigine Valley relies upon an OpenGL 3 core profile context. Learn more via the OpenBenchmarking.org test page.
Xonotic
This is a benchmark of Xonotic, which is a fork of the DarkPlaces-based Nexuiz game. Development began in March of 2010 on the Xonotic game. Learn more via the OpenBenchmarking.org test page.
